Would you like to join City & Guilds as a Scrutineer/Assessment Reviewer?

Our Scrutineers:

- Carry out final checks on assessment materials, including question papers and mark scheme/marking guidance at the point it is deemed to be final draft.

- Complete the scrutineer report form with suggested solutions to issues/concerns.

- Without reference to the mark scheme(s)/marking guidance, sit the final drafts of all assessment materials as a candidate within the allocated time.

- Review the assessment materials, where appropriate checking there are no errors, omissions, or ambiguities in the assessments.

- Complete the scrutineer report form with suggested solutions to issues/concerns, with assessment materials or mark schemes/marking guidance.

- Submit completed scrutineer report form to City & Guilds, responding to any communication requesting clarification or further discussion.

The Scrutineer must be a subject matter expert for the assessment they are carrying out a scrutiny check for and must not have been part of the writing or editing phase of the assessment production.
